Բովանդակություն:

RGB Led WS2812B ինտերֆեյսի ձեռնարկ Arduino UNO- ով. 7 քայլ (նկարներով)
RGB Led WS2812B ինտերֆեյսի ձեռնարկ Arduino UNO- ով. 7 քայլ (նկարներով)

Video: RGB Led WS2812B ինտերֆեյսի ձեռնարկ Arduino UNO- ով. 7 քայլ (նկարներով)

Video: RGB Led WS2812B ինտերֆեյսի ձեռնարկ Arduino UNO- ով. 7 քայլ (նկարներով)
Video: DIY Pixel Light Addressable 5050 RGB Circle 5V WS2812B LED Ring 2024, Հուլիսի
Anonim
RGB RGB Led WS2812B ինտերֆեյսի ձեռնարկ ՝ Arduino UNO- ի հետ
RGB RGB Led WS2812B ինտերֆեյսի ձեռնարկ ՝ Arduino UNO- ի հետ

Այս ձեռնարկը ձեզ կսովորեցնի որոշ հիմունքներ ՝ Sparkfun RGB Led WS2812B- ն Arduino UNO- ի հետ օգտագործելու վերաբերյալ:

Քայլ 1: Ներածություն

Նկարագրություն:

Սա ընդմիջման տախտակ է WS2812B RGB LED- ի համար: WS2812B- ը (կամ «NeoPixel») իրականում RGB LED է ՝ WS2811- ով ՝ ներկառուցված անմիջապես LED- ի մեջ: Բոլոր անհրաժեշտ քորոցները բաժանված են 0,1 դյույմանոց վերնագրերի ՝ հացը հեշտ տեղավորելու համար: Այս ճեղքումներից մի քանիսը նույնիսկ կարող են շղթայված լինել ՝ ձևավորելով ցուցադրում կամ հասցեավորվող տող:

Տեխնիկական պայմաններ.

1. Չափը ՝ 50 մմ x 50 մմ 2: Գունավոր էկրան ՝ կարմիր, կանաչ, կապույտ

3. Դիտման անկյուն ՝ 120 աստիճան

4. Կարմիր ՝ (620-630 նմ) @ 550-700 մկդ

5. Կանաչ ՝ (515-530 նմ) @ 1100-1400 մկդ

6. Կապույտ. (465-475nm) @ 200-400 մկդ

7. Նկարագրություն.

VCC - Մուտքային լարումը 5V

GND - Ընդհանուր, գրունտային, 0V հղման մատակարարման լարումը:

DI - Միկրոկոնտրոլերի տվյալները մտնում են այս քորոցում:

DO - Տվյալները տեղափոխվում են այս քորոցից, որպեսզի միացվեն մեկ այլ պիքսելի մուտքին կամ մնան լողացող, եթե դա շղթայի վերջին օղակն է:

Քայլ 2: Պին սահմանում

Pin սահմանում
Pin սահմանում

Քայլ 3: Սարքավորումների տեղադրում

Սարքավորումների տեղադրում
Սարքավորումների տեղադրում
Սարքավորումների տեղադրում
Սարքավորումների տեղադրում

Քայլ 4: Նմուշի կոդ

Արդյունքը ստանալու համար խնդրում ենք ներբեռնել ստորև բերված նմուշի կոդի նմուշը:

Քայլ 5. Ներառեք Adafruit_NeoPixel.h գրադարանը

Ներառեք Adafruit_NeoPixel.h գրադարանը
Ներառեք Adafruit_NeoPixel.h գրադարանը
Ներառեք Adafruit_NeoPixel.h գրադարանը
Ներառեք Adafruit_NeoPixel.h գրադարանը

Կտտացրեք skecth, ապա գտեք ներառված գրադարանը և կտտացրեք կառավարել գրադարանը: Հաջորդը, որոնեք adafruit neopixel- ը և տեղադրեք վերջին տարբերակը

Քայլ 6: Վերբեռնեք աղբյուրի կոդը

Վերբեռնեք աղբյուրի կոդը
Վերբեռնեք աղբյուրի կոդը
Վերբեռնեք աղբյուրի կոդը
Վերբեռնեք աղբյուրի կոդը

Բացեք աղբյուրի կոդը: Համոզվեք, որ arduino UNO և com port- ը նույնն են, և խնդրում ենք ընտրել, որ Arduino UNO- ի տախտակն է:

Սեղմեք վերբեռնում:

Խորհուրդ ենք տալիս: